USU intends to award a sole-source, firm-fixed-price contract with a base year and up to four option years to Watermark for software platform implementation and licensing for accreditation planning and self-study and course evaluations and surveys software subscriptions. Training Analysis Evaluation Product Request for Proposal (8A Set Aside)
Solicitation # M6785426R8017
The Marine Corps Systems Command plans to award a single Indefinite Delivery Indefinite Quantity (IDIQ) contract exclusively to an 8(a) certified small business for the Training Analysis Evaluation Product (TAEP), with the solicitation number M6785426R8017 expected to be released in the fourth quarter of FY26. This procurement is set aside for 8(a) small businesses under FAR Subpart 19.8 and will be primarily Firm-Fixed-Price with limited cost-reimbursable elements, awarded on a best-value tradeoff basis. The contract will support the full life cycle management of Marine Corps training systems through task orders that include cognitive, needs, gap, job task, and training system analyses; evaluations of training effectiveness, fidelity, and functionality; and the development of key documentation such as training situation documents, evaluation reports, and instructional requirements packages. All work will be performed within a military environment and may involve supporting new technology acquisition, major end item procurement, and sustainment of existing training systems. The primary NAICS code is 611710 with a size standard of $24 million, and the Product Service Code is U008. The contract will allow for maximum flexibility through expedited task order issuance, with Task Order Performance Work Statements superseding the base PWS in case of conflict. Responses must be submitted via SAM.gov, and all offerors are required to maintain an active SAM registration with current representations and certifications. Questions should be directed to Karla Logothety or Anitra Kinsey at the provided email addresses.

Restricted Keyway System Upgrade & Lock Hardware Standardization
Solicitation # HU000126QE033
Solicitation HU000126QE033 is a Firm Fixed Price contract issued by the Uniformed Services University of the Health Sciences for a Restricted Keyway System Upgrade and Lock Hardware Standardization project. The work is located at the Armed Forces Radiobiology Research Institute in Bethesda, Maryland, and is designated as a total small business set-aside. The project involves the comprehensive replacement and upgrade of door hardware, including the installation of various leversets, mortise lock retrofits, deadbolts, exit devices, and the integration of 18 padlocks into a master keying system. All hardware must conform to specific brushed chrome or satin stainless steel finishes. The contract is estimated to be valued under 25,000 dollars. Award decisions will be based on a best-value trade-off analysis, evaluating technical solutions, vendor quality control, past performance via government databases, and price reasonableness. The contractor is responsible for providing a material delivery timeline and an installation schedule following the delivery of all materials. Invoicing and payment processing will be managed electronically through the Wide Area WorkFlow system. Proposals must be submitted via email and include a detailed technical overview, price quote, and required company identifiers such as the UEI and CAGE code.
